Cutting-Edge Technologies Transforming Medical Research

At the heart of these advancements are a myriad of cutting-edge technologies that are transforming how we conduct medical research. Artificial intelligence (AI) has emerged as a game-changing tool, allowing researchers to sift through vast amounts of data and identify patterns that would have otherwise gone unnoticed. AI algorithms can predict patient outcomes, assist in diagnosis, and even suggest potential treatment plans. This not only enhances accuracy but also facilitates personalized medicine, tailoring treatments to individual genetic profiles.

Genomics, the study of an organism’s complete set of DNA, is another arena where we are witnessing groundbreaking changes. Thanks to advancements in gene sequencing technologies, researchers are now able to identify genetic markers linked to diseases, paving the way for personalized treatment strategies. Rather than a one-size-fits-all approach, patients can receive tailored therapies that maximize treatment efficacy while minimizing side effects. The promise of genomic research is vast and could soon lead to cures for diseases that once seemed insurmountable.

Alongside these technologies, innovations in medical imaging and diagnostic tools are making significant strides. Techniques like MRI, PET scans, and 3D imaging are getting sharper and more effective every day, enabling healthcare providers to diagnose conditions early and with unprecedented accuracy. These advancements allow for timely interventions, which can significantly improve patient outcomes.

Promising Areas of Research in Healthcare

The horizon of medical research is filled with promising avenues that signal a hopeful future for healthcare. One of the most exciting developments in recent years is the advancement of immunotherapy in cancer treatment. This treatment harnesses the body’s own immune system to target and destroy cancer cells. Research has shown that immunotherapy can lead to remarkable recoveries in patients with many types of cancer, opening up new avenues of hope for those facing dire diagnoses.

Moreover, regenerative medicine and stem cell therapy are pushing the boundaries of what’s possible in healing and recovery. Scientists are exploring methods to repair damaged tissues and even regenerate entire organs, which could provide solutions for conditions that currently require transplants or lifelong management. Imagine a future where organ donor shortages could be a thing of the past, thanks to the ability to grow new organs from a patient’s own cells!

In addition, advancements in mental health research are reshaping our understanding of psychological well-being. Digital therapeutics—software-based interventions—are being studied for their effectiveness in treating conditions such as anxiety, depression, and PTSD. These programs offer accessibility and flexibility, enabling more people to seek help in a manner that fits their lifestyle. The ability to address mental health through innovative research is not just a revelation; it signifies a shift towards a society that prioritizes emotional well-being as much as physical health.

Challenges Facing Medical Research Today

No discussion of medical research would be complete without acknowledging the challenges it faces. Ethical considerations in clinical trials continue to be paramount. Ensuring that patients provide informed consent and that their rights are protected is vital in maintaining trust in the research process. Balancing the need for rapid innovation with the necessity for ethical standards is a tightrope that researchers must walk.

Furthermore, disparities in healthcare access remain a significant hurdle. Historically, certain demographic groups have been underrepresented in clinical trials, leading to healthcare solutions that may not address the needs of everyone. Researchers and policymakers alike must work diligently to promote inclusivity in research practices, ensuring that all populations can benefit from medical advancements.

Regulatory hurdles also pose challenges for rapid innovation. Navigating the complex web of regulations that govern clinical trials and new medical products can slow down the pace of breakthroughs. However, it’s important to remember that these regulations are in place to protect patient safety and wellbeing. Advocating for more streamlined processes while maintaining rigorous safety standards is essential for creating an environment where innovation can flourish.
